├── .gitignore ├── LICENSE ├── README.md ├── kubernetes ├── headless_service.yaml ├── ingress.yaml ├── service.yaml └── statefulset.yaml ├── project ├── build.properties └── plugins.sbt └── src └── main ├── resources └── application.conf └── scala ├── Main.scala ├── cluster ├── CacheDataActor.scala ├── ClusterShardRegion.scala └── ClusterStateInformer.scala └── http └── Route.scala /.gitignore: -------------------------------------------------------------------------------- 1 | *.class 2 | *.log 3 | -------------------------------------------------------------------------------- /LICENSE: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/LICENSE -------------------------------------------------------------------------------- /README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/README.md -------------------------------------------------------------------------------- /kubernetes/headless_service.yaml: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/kubernetes/headless_service.yaml -------------------------------------------------------------------------------- /kubernetes/ingress.yaml: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/kubernetes/ingress.yaml -------------------------------------------------------------------------------- /kubernetes/service.yaml: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/kubernetes/service.yaml -------------------------------------------------------------------------------- /kubernetes/statefulset.yaml: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/kubernetes/statefulset.yaml -------------------------------------------------------------------------------- /project/build.properties: -------------------------------------------------------------------------------- 1 | sbt.version = 1.1.0 -------------------------------------------------------------------------------- /project/plugins.sbt: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/project/plugins.sbt -------------------------------------------------------------------------------- /src/main/resources/application.conf: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/src/main/resources/application.conf -------------------------------------------------------------------------------- /src/main/scala/Main.scala: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/src/main/scala/Main.scala -------------------------------------------------------------------------------- /src/main/scala/cluster/CacheDataActor.scala: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/src/main/scala/cluster/CacheDataActor.scala -------------------------------------------------------------------------------- /src/main/scala/cluster/ClusterShardRegion.scala: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/src/main/scala/cluster/ClusterShardRegion.scala -------------------------------------------------------------------------------- /src/main/scala/cluster/ClusterStateInformer.scala: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/src/main/scala/cluster/ClusterStateInformer.scala -------------------------------------------------------------------------------- /src/main/scala/http/Route.scala: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/sharma-rohit/distributed-cache-on-k8s-poc/HEAD/src/main/scala/http/Route.scala --------------------------------------------------------------------------------